To write right-to-left in Linux, press Right-ALT+]
and end by ALT+P
.
To write left-to-right in Linux, press Right-ALT+[
.
Use RLE
and PDF
to begin and end a right-to-left embedding. The unicode for
LRE
is U+202A
, the unicode for RLE
is U+202B
and the unicode for PDF
is U+202C
. In Ubuntu, hold CTRL-SHIFT
to type a unicode character. For
example, to type an RLE
, press the following keys: CTRL SHIFT U + 2 0 2 B
.
Hold the left ALT and the right SHIFT keys to switch the Ubuntu keyboard layout.
